What Makes a Smart Speaker Stand Out?
Smart speakers go beyond traditional Bluetooth options by integrating voice assistants such as Alexa, allowing hands-free operation. Whether you're in the kitchen whipping up dinner, working from home, or relaxing in the living room, these devices respond to voice commands for playing tunes, setting timers, controlling lights, or even providing weather updates. Unlike basic Bluetooth speakers, smart models offer seamless connectivity to your ecosystem of devices, making them essential for tech-savvy homes.

Frequently Asked Questions
What's the difference between smart speakers and regular portable speakers?
Smart speakers include built-in voice assistants for control without apps or buttons, plus smart home integration, unlike basic portables focused solely on audio playback.
Are these smart speakers compatible with other devices?
Yes, most support Bluetooth, Wi-Fi, and ecosystems like Alexa, working with lights, thermostats, and more from various brands.

How do I set up a smart speaker?
Download the companion app, connect to Wi-Fi, and follow voice-guided pairing—most are ready in minutes.
